WebSep 28, 2024 · To start adding stability to the ankle, place an anchor at the bottom inside the edge of the foot, about mid arch. Once secure, place a 25-50% stretch on the tape as you wrap it under the arch, across the 5th metatarsal and at a slight angle so that it rests behind the ankle bone itself. WebSep 4, 2024 · Work your way up by wrapping the bandage several times around your foot and ankle in a figure-eight pattern. Keep the bandage taut. Please note that the video above demonstrates the correct technique for an … WebPlace the foot in a neutral position with the big toe bending downward slightly. Wrap the tape from the bottom of your big toe around your heel and back across the bottom of your foot to the starting position. Use a 1-inch-wide strip. The tape should go from inside the foot to outside the foot.

WebMay 18, 2024 · Place one end on the ball of your foot and extend it to one inch before the heel with no stretch. Take a second piece of one inch wide tape and apply it to the ball of the foot with some stretch and press down the edges to the top of the foot.
